Summary: | media-libs/gexiv2-0.12.0-r1 Stable Request |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Brian Evans (RETIRED) <grknight> |
Component: | Stabilization | Assignee: | Gentoo Linux Gnome Desktop Team <gnome> |
Status: | RESOLVED FIXED | ||
Severity: | normal | Keywords: | STABLEREQ |
Priority: | Normal | Flags: | nattka:
sanity-check+
|
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: |
media-libs/gexiv2-0.12.0-r1
|
Runtime testing required: | --- |
Bug Depends on: | |||
Bug Blocks: | 719196 |
Description
Brian Evans (RETIRED)
2020-03-07 12:54:37 UTC
The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=dda088b56c4419fbec7f64b4583c2dcb3b11cfc8 commit dda088b56c4419fbec7f64b4583c2dcb3b11cfc8 Author: Mart Raudsepp <leio@gentoo.org> AuthorDate: 2020-04-14 16:58:42 +0000 Commit: Mart Raudsepp <leio@gentoo.org> CommitDate: 2020-04-14 17:00:03 +0000 media-libs/gexiv2: fix deps, add py3.8, disable vala tool * Fix gexiv2 minimum dep per meson, re-sort in appearance order * Fix python dep to be USE=python conditional; add missing pygobject * Add python3_8 to PYTHON_COMPAT - just simple g-i overrides that should be OK with it, and appear to be on other distros * Add missing gtk-doc docbook dep * Disable a new vala requiring tool. This would really have to be conditional to USE=vala, possibly behind an extra USE flag. But it has questionable value and is not shipped by other distros either, so just unconditionally disable it for the time being After this I can consider this appropriate for stabling Bug: https://bugs.gentoo.org/711784 Package-Manager: Portage-2.3.84, Repoman-2.3.20 Signed-off-by: Mart Raudsepp <leio@gentoo.org> media-libs/gexiv2/gexiv2-0.12.0-r1.ebuild | 74 +++++++++++++++++++++++++++++++ 1 file changed, 74 insertions(+) Lets let this simmer for a couple days - after that I'm amenable to CC arches for -r1 if no problems crop up sparc stable arm64 stable amd64 stable arm stable x86 stable Looking good on ppc. rdep gimp-2.8.22-r1 fails tests (bug #669080). # cat gexiv2-711784.report USE tests started on Mi 29. Apr 19:55:11 CEST 2020 FEATURES=' test' USE='python'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c -introspection -python -static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c -introspection -python -static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c introspection -python -static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c introspection -python -static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c -introspection -python static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c -introspection -python static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c introspection -python static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c introspection -python static-libs -v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c introspection -python -static-libs v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c introspection -python -static-libs v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='-gtk-doc introspection -python static-libs vala' succeeded for =media-libs/gexiv2-0.12.0-r1 USE='gtk-doc introspection -python static-libs vala' succeeded for =media-libs/gexiv2-0.12.0-r1 revdep tests started on Mi 29. Apr 20:15:47 CEST 2020 FEATURES=' test' failed for media-gfx/gimp ppc stable ppc64 stable. Closing. |